What is CoolSculpting, and how does it work?

CoolSculpting is the first FDA-cleared technology to eliminate fat using cooling technology. The technology targets fat cells, and once the fat cells are frozen, they are permanently and naturally eliminated from the body. The scientific or technical term for the fat-freezing process is cryolipolysis. 

“During treatment, paddles are placed on the target treatment area,” shares Pedroni, “The cooling technology gets down to -11 degrees fahrenheit to target the fat cells in the treatment area, and the surrounding cells of the treatment area are protected and remain intact.”

How does CoolSculpting work for knee fat?

“CoolSculpting for knee fat uses the same science as any other area being treated with CoolSculpting Elite,” shares Pedroni, “The cryolipolysis temperature gets to -11 degrees, treating the most uncommon area of fat.” 

The CoolSculpting paddles are placed on the targeted area, and the cooling technology gets to work to freeze the unwanted fat cells, leaving the surrounding fat cells intact. 

Who is the ideal client for a CoolSculpting knee fat treatment?

“When treating the knees with CoolSculpting Elite, candidates need to have the really squishy fat bulge around the knees,” states Pedroni, “The knees are one of the most difficult areas to treat in my personal opinion, so it’s essential the client meets the ideal standards.”

What results can you expect to see in knee fat reduction?

Pedroni indicates that clients who are candidates for knees “can expect the fat pad around the area to be reduced by 20% to 25%, making the area more firm & less bulging.”

What other areas does CoolSculpting treat?

CoolSculpting is used to treat visible fat bulges in nine other areas of the body, including the submandibular (under the jawline) area, abdomen, flank, thigh, underneath the buttocks, upper arm, submental (under the chin) area, along with back fat and bra fat.

Is CoolSculpting weight loss or fat loss?

CoolSculpting is fat loss, not weight loss. We are all born with a set number of fat cells that do not change throughout life. The size of the fat cells changes as we gain and lose weight. If you lose weight, your fat cells are shrinking in size, and if you gain weight, they are increasing in size.

CoolSculpting freezes fat cells in targeted areas, and those fat cells are eliminated from the body, which results in a loss of inches and not necessarily a loss in weight. Once the fat cells are eliminated, they are gone for good.
